Castor3D 0.16.0
Multiplatform 3D engine
castor3d::PassBuffer::PassDataPtr Member List

This is the complete list of members for castor3d::PassBuffer::PassDataPtr, including all inherited members.

PassDataPtr(castor::ByteArrayView data)castor3d::PassBuffer::PassDataPtrinlineexplicit
write(MemChunk const &chunk, uint32_t v, VkDeviceSize offset)castor3d::PassBuffer::PassDataPtr
write(MemChunk const &chunk, int32_t v, VkDeviceSize offset)castor3d::PassBuffer::PassDataPtr
write(MemChunk const &chunk, float v, VkDeviceSize offset)castor3d::PassBuffer::PassDataPtr
write(MemChunk const &chunk, DataA a, DataB b, VkDeviceSize offset)castor3d::PassBuffer::PassDataPtrinline
write(MemChunk const &chunk, DataA a, DataB b, DataC c, VkDeviceSize offset)castor3d::PassBuffer::PassDataPtrinline
write(MemChunk const &chunk, DataA a, DataB b, DataC c, DataD d, VkDeviceSize offset)castor3d::PassBuffer::PassDataPtrinline
write(MemChunk const &chunk, castor::Array< DataT, SizeT > const &v, VkDeviceSize offset)castor3d::PassBuffer::PassDataPtrinline
write(MemChunk const &chunk, castor::Point< DataT, CountT > const &v, VkDeviceSize offset)castor3d::PassBuffer::PassDataPtrinline
write(MemChunk const &chunk, castor::RgbColour const &v, VkDeviceSize offset)castor3d::PassBuffer::PassDataPtrinline
write(MemChunk const &chunk, castor::HdrRgbColour const &v, VkDeviceSize offset)castor3d::PassBuffer::PassDataPtrinline
write(MemChunk const &chunk, castor::RgbaColour const &v, VkDeviceSize offset)castor3d::PassBuffer::PassDataPtrinline
write(MemChunk const &chunk, castor::HdrRgbaColour const &v, VkDeviceSize offset)castor3d::PassBuffer::PassDataPtrinline